Detailed Answer with Explanation:

Idea: Round each number to the nearest hundred before adding.

Rounding rule (to nearest hundred)

  • Look at the tens digit.
  • If tens digit \(\ge 5\), round up to the next hundred.
  • If tens digit \(\le 4\), round down to the previous hundred.

(a) 874 + 478

  1. \(874:\) tens digit \(=7\) \(\Rightarrow\) round up \(\to 900\).
  2. \(478:\) tens digit \(=7\) \(\Rightarrow\) round up \(\to 500\).
  3. Estimated sum: \(900 + 500 = 1400\).

(b) 793 + 397

  1. \(793:\) tens digit \(=9\) \(\Rightarrow\) round up \(\to 800\).
  2. \(397:\) tens digit \(=9\) \(\Rightarrow\) round up \(\to 400\).
  3. Estimated sum: \(800 + 400 = 1200\).

(c) 11244 + 3507

  1. \(11244:\) tens digit \(=4\) \(\Rightarrow\) round down \(\to 11200\).
  2. \(3507:\) tens digit \(=0\) \(\Rightarrow\) round down \(\to 3500\).
  3. Estimated sum: \(11200 + 3500 = 14700\).

(d) 17677 + 13589

  1. \(17677:\) tens digit \(=7\) \(\Rightarrow\) round up \(\to 17700\).
  2. \(13589:\) tens digit \(=8\) \(\Rightarrow\) round up \(\to 13600\).
  3. Estimated sum: \(17700 + 13600 = 31300\).
